What is RMG Acquisition III Tangible Book per Share?

Tangible book value per share is calculated as the total tangible equity divided by Shares Outstanding (EOP). Total tangible equity is calculated as the Total Stockholders Equity minus Preferred Stock minus Intangible Assets. RMG Acquisition III's tangible book value per share for the quarter that ended in Sep. 2023 was $-0.87.

Since intangibles such as goodwill cannot be sold when the company liquidates, tangible book value per share is considered more accurate in reflecting how much shareholders will receive when the company liquidates.

RMG Acquisition III Tangible Book per Share Calculation

RMG Acquisition III's Tangible Book Value Per Share for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2022 is calculated as

Tangible Book Value per Share=(Total Stockholders Equity-Preferred Stock-Intangible Assets)/Shares Outstanding (EOP)
=(467.977-0-0)/60.375
=7.75

RMG Acquisition III's Tangible Book Value Per Share for the quarter that ended in Sep. 2023 is calculated as

Tangible Book Value per Share=(Total Stockholders Equity-Preferred Stock-Intangible Assets)/Shares Outstanding (EOP)
=(-11.042-0-0)/12.7108
=-0.87

RMG Acquisition III  (OTCPK:RMGCF) Tangible Book per Share Explanation

Usually a company's book value and Tangible Book per Share may not reflect its true value. The assets may be carried on the balance sheets at the original cost minus depreciation. This may underestimate the true economic values of the assets. It also may over-estimate their true economic value because the assets can become obsolete.

For financial companies such as banks and insurance companies, their assets may be reported in current market value of the assets owned. Book values of financial companies are more accurate indicator of the economic value of the company.
